What to know about Pulmonary Arterial Hypertension (PAH)

STATEPOINT – Each year, an estimated 500-1,000 people nationwide are diagnosed with pulmonary arterial hypertension (PAH). While there’s currently no cure, treatment can help control symptoms and improve quality of life.
